Ikenna Nwachukwu, Appellant, v. GFI Group, Inc., et al., Respondents. Index No. 30201/2008


Unpublished Opinion

MOTION DECISION

MARK C. DILLON, J.P., COLLEEN D. DUFFY, LINDA CHRISTOPHER, PAUL WOOTEN, JJ.

DECISION & ORDER ON MOTION

Appeal from an order of the Supreme Court, Kings County, dated December 10, 2019, which was deemed dismissed pursuant to 22 NYCRR 1250.10(a). Motion by the appellant pursuant to 22 NYCRR 1250.10(c) to vacate the dismissal of the appeal and to extend the time to perfect the appeal.

Upon the papers filed in support of the motion and the papers filed in opposition thereto, it is

ORDERED that the motion is denied.

DILLON, J.P., DUFFY, CHRISTOPHER and WOOTEN, JJ., concur.
